Snippet
Cr 2 O 3 thin films were synthesized by RF magnetron sputtering of a Cr target in an oxygen- argon plasma. The effect of annealing temperature on the structural, electrical, and gas- sensitive properties of the Cr 2 O 3 thin films was studied. According to AFM, SEM, XRD …
